What is a legal associate?

Legal Associates are early-career lawyers who support more senior attorneys in a law firm or legal department. They conduct legal research, draft documents, assist with case preparation, and may represent clients under supervision. Legal Associates are typically recent law school graduates who have passed the bar exam, and their role is designed to provide hands-on experience while allowing them to develop their legal skills. Over time, Legal Associates may work toward becoming partners or taking on more senior legal positions within their organization.

What is the difference between Legal Associate vs Paralegal?

AspectLegal AssociateParalegal
Required CredentialsJuris Doctor (JD), bar admission often preferredAssociate's degree or paralegal certification
Work EnvironmentLaw firms, corporate legal departments, government agenciesLaw firms, legal departments, courts, corporate offices
Job ResponsibilitiesLegal research, drafting documents, client interaction, assisting attorneysLegal research, document preparation, case organization, support tasks

Legal Associates typically hold a JD and are licensed to practice law, performing more advanced legal tasks. Paralegals assist attorneys with research and administrative duties but do not require a law degree or license. Both roles work in similar environments, but Legal Associates have a broader scope of responsibilities and legal authority.

Legal Assistant

Way Finders is a Top Workplaces for Nonprofit organization, named as an employer of choice because our employees said so!  

At Way Finders, we are passionately invested in lifting up the region’s people, places, and systems. Though our team performs a wide variety of functions, we are united by our shared mission: to build and advocate for a thriving region; to improve the stability and economic mobility of families and individuals; and to develop and manage a robust range of safe, affordable housing options.

Interested in joining our team of dedicated professionals? Way Finders is currently seeking a Legal Assistant for our Legal department. The Legal Assistant supports our mission by providing legal administrative support to the Chief Legal Officer, Managing Attorney, and Attorneys, by filing legal documents, responding to inquiries, establishing and maintaining efficient processes, and taking ownership of myriad administrative functions.

Benefits include:  20 days of accrued paid time-off in year one | 15+ holidays annually | Health, dental, and vision insurance options FROM DAY ONE | Educational assistance | Medical Reimbursement Account | Dependent Care Account | 403(b) retirement plan with employer match | Life insurance | Short-term and long-term disability insurance | Transportation benefits | Employee Assistance Program | Annual staff picnic!

Wage starts between $25.50 and $29.00 per hour depending on equivalent qualifications. Interested applicants must submit a resume and cover letter; applications will be accepted until the position is filled.
The candidate may work in a hybrid-remote capacity but must live within commutable distance to our main office. Weekly in-office workdays will be scheduled.

Responsibilities include:
•    Prepare draft legal documents and correspondence
•    File documents and pleadings with courts
•    Draft routine correspondence on behalf of attorneys; review, edit, and prepare signature documents as appropriate
•    Monitor all legal correspondence, reviewing inquiries and supporting materials and responding to internal clients and external stakeholders, including attorneys, landlords, clients, and court personnel 
•    Use judgment in the receipt, response and/or referral of emails from internal and external stakeholders, seeking guidance and direction when appropriate to determine desired action to be taken
•    Track project deadlines and/or escalating issues to the Chief Legal Officer and/or Managing Attorney as needed
•    Prepare written office procedures for tasks given
•    Perform basic administrative, clerical, and office support tasks, to include:  scheduling meetings; copying, scanning, assembling, retrieving, indexing, and purging files; maintaining spreadsheets and databases; and preparing and distributing mailings
•    Create and maintain spreadsheets and databases of records and other information
•    Identify and maintain new processes to improve efficiency within the legal team
•    Enter data on legal data points, including KPIs and deadlines, using established databases and other tracking systems
•    Maintain and organize legal team file system, both physically and electronically

Requirements include:
•    2 years’ equivalent experience with 1 year in the legal field; an Associate or relevant certification may substitute for some experience
•    Preference for experience in a law firm or in-house environment with a variety of civil litigation or real estate transaction matters
•    Adept with technology including Office365 and databases; comfort learning new software systems
•    Familiarity with legal terminology and processes
•    Superior proficiency in working in databases and the Microsoft Suite (including Excel), with comfort learning new technologies; preference for experience working in Filevine or a similar database
•    Excellent organizational skills with the ability to establish priorities and schedule activities as necessary to complete all tasks in a timely manner, achieve deadlines, and effectively multi-task
•    Proven ability to maintain confidentiality in legal matters 
•    Attention to detail
•    Ability to work independently and as part of a team
